BIOGRAPHY
Parag Kulkarni is an Associate Professor at the College of IT, UAE University. Before joining UAEU, he spent a decade at Toshiba’s Telecommunications Research Laboratory (TRL) in Bristol, UK where he led a team of researchers and was actively engaged in research, intellectual property generation, technology transfer, standardisation and outreach activities in wide ranging areas such as Internet of Things (IoT), ICT for sustainability (energy and water resources management), smart cities and next generation wireless systems. He is broadly interested in technology and the role it can play to solve problems in different domains and the associated commercialization aspects. He is a (co)inventor on over a dozen patents, recipient of a Toshiba R&D award for co-developing a technology that was successfully commercialized, has widely published his work and has served the community in various capacities such as panelist, industry forum speaker, conference and workshop co-chair and program committee member. He obtained his B.Tech degree from the National Institute of Technology Calicut India and the PhD degree from the University of Ulster in the UK.
